Output d4833000ec0f4f9abf1b8462d26d71d1d5c4bec46cfc48a801b18c0b1651b5bf:6

value
20582316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99fb53009199bca93b9365308e206a3e9ae91750 OP_EQUAL
address
MMwLh6PTRwS4BuCGCMbQRzKMFupbVKzWc1
transaction
d4833000ec0f4f9abf1b8462d26d71d1d5c4bec46cfc48a801b18c0b1651b5bf
spent
true